    Default Vauxhall! Need sum advice

    In june last year i purchased a brand new vauxhall astra from pentengon. I visited the showroom twice before i purchased the car for information about the model i wanted. The salesman i was dealing with told me the model i wanted came with alloy wheels. I signed the contract with them for the car and paid the deposit and took out finance for the rest. When the car came the wheels did look like alloy wheels. Only 2 weeks ago i got a flat tire and had to change my wheel. At this point i realised the wheels were not alloy wheels. I was quite upset with this and contacted vauxhall. They told me i paid for what i got and there was nothin i could do. I explained that the salesman told me the car came with alloys and i had 4 withnesses that were present when he said this. The man then said that he knew the salesman and he would never have had said this.

    In my eyes i didnt get the correct product that i was verbally sold but the salesman and have 4 witnesses who agree.

    Do i have any rights in this case?

    Default Re: Vauxhall! Need sum advice

    If you have 4 witnesses, get signed statements from each one. The write to the garage with copies of the statements and warn them that you wil go to court unless they give you what was agreed.

    If they don't cooperate - then make a claim.
    Don't bother writing to them if you are not prepared to go ahead with the claim

    Default Re: Vauxhall! Need sum advice

    If you paid on finance complain to the finance company. Under Section 56 of the consumer credit act they are liable for any representations made by their agent, in this case the salesman. Get your statements as advised and then invoke the complaints procedure of the finance co. If that doesn't work complain to the financial Ombudsmanicon.

    Default Re: Vauxhall! Need sum advice

    Have you checked the exact specification for the model you purcahsed; some come with alloys as standard for a particular spec. elite, club, design etc.
    some are optional extras and if so will be listed on the invoice! At least you may not have been charged for them!
